Hard Cover. Condition: As New. Dust Jacket Condition: As New. "The Definitive Guide to the Sweat Magazine Genre!" Paying homage to the American periodicals of the 1950s, 1960s, and 1970s that documented outrageous exploits, this hefty, comprehensive guide is packed full of colorful cover art, sumptuous sample spreads, and enlightening essays.
